Не работает связка GPS и Ethernet ENC28J60 на Atmega328

finderto
Offline
Зарегистрирован: 11.04.2013

Все привет!. решил сдедать простую телеметрию для р/у машинки. Появилась проблема связкиGPS и Ethernet. 

использую для этого Atmega328P-PU(http://www.hobbytronics.co.uk/image/data/tutorial/arduino-hardcore/atmega328-arduino-pinout.jpg)

Подключил к Atmega328P Ethernet ENC28J60 к пинам 10,11,12,13. Все работает. Подцепил также датчик температуры (Dallas DS18B). работает! 

Решил подключить GPS к пину 9 - GPS не работает. Если  подключить GPS к 10 пину, то GPS работает.

 

НО! Если подключить Ehternet к  9,11,12,13 то плата работает. но вот если подключить GPS к 10 пину И  Ehternet к  9,11,12,13 то все перестает работать. 

Помогите разобраться с проблемой. Заранее спасибо!

 

PS если подключить все это дело к MEga2560. причем ethernet Нужно подключать к 50,51,52,53 а GPS к 10  работает. но мне нужно воспользоваться только Atmega328

Апрайсин
Апрайсин аватар
Offline
Зарегистрирован: 05.08.2013

какие библиотеки? какие коды?